如何使用discuz! q构建和发布小程序-尊龙游戏旗舰厅官网

说明

的与h5前端,基于uni-app开发框架,现支持发行为微信和h5。

使用方法

1. 安装discuz! q

在使用discuz! q小程序之前,请先安装好你的discuz! q,具体方法请,查看安装文档。

2. 准备hbuilderx

  • 安装,下载alpha版
  • 安装uni-app编译插件
  • 点击,点击『使用hbuilderx导入插件』,安装sass编译插件

3. 准备小程序开发工具

启动微信开发者工具,打开工具 > 设置 > 安全设置,将服务端口开启。

4. 建立discuz! q项目

如果你使用的是v2.8.1以上的hbuilder x,选择 文件 > 新建 > 项目 > uni-app > 选择 discuz! q模板

如果你的hbuilder x中看不到discuz! q模板,可点击,然后选择『使用hbuilderx导入插件』

5. 修改配置,指向自己的服务器

修改 common/const.js 文件中的以下两行:

export const discuz_title = "设置为自己小程序的标题";
let host = "设置为自己discuz! q的访问地址,比如https://discuz.chat/";

6. 发行

选择 发行 > 小程序 – 微信,输入自己的小程序id,即可生成微信小程序,并自动在微信开发工具中打开。在微信开发工具中选择上传即可。

也可以选择 发行 > 网站 – h5手机版,生成h5页面,然后上传到discuz! q的服务器上,覆盖原public目录下的index.html和static目录。

不使用hbuilder

如果你对npm工具链比较熟悉,不想使用hbuilder x,也可以自己通过npm进行构建。

下载小程序代码

请下载,并解压缩到一个目录中。

构建过程

进入解压缩后的目录,修改 .env.production 文件,将其中的服务器指向自己的discuz! q地址。

修改src下的manifest.json文件,将其中的小程序id换成自己的小程序id

然后执行:

npm config set registry http://mirrors.cloud.tencent.com/npm/
npm install
npm run build:mp-weixin

上传小程序

通过微信开发工具,打开构建完的小程序目录,即可上传

未经允许不得转载:尊龙游戏旗舰厅官网 » 如何使用discuz! q构建和发布小程序

网站地图